The UK Chapter Meeting will be held in London on 6th March at the Royal College of Physicians near Regents Park. This is a member only event.  Tickets are £420+VAT per delegate

Our theme is:

Telling better stories to make an impact


Here are our Sessions so far:

Why Should Anyone Listen to You?

Speaker: Danny Wain, Daniel Wain Consulting

Cultural Storytelling: Using Semiotics & Language Analysis to Build More Successful Healthcare Brands

Speakers: Alex Gordon and Mark Lemon, Sign Salad

Illustrating Lupus: Creative Storytelling Through Graphic Medicine to Transform Patient Education

Speakers: Mohamed Akrout, Roche and Gregg Quy, Elma Research

Do Avatars Make Better Storytellers?

Speaker: Dan Coffin and Sarah Bangs, Research Partnership

Goldilocks: Villain or Victim? The importance of narrative perspective in great stories.

Speakers: Viv Farr and Lucy Oates, Narrative Health

Activating commercial change through storytelling

Speaker: Nicole Duckworth, 4twenty2
